Session request forgery via _table_id script injection
Published Dec 13, 2024 · Updated Dec 13, 2024
Cross-site scripting in Combodo iTop before 2.7.11 and 3.0.0-alpha through 3.1.1 allows remote authenticated users to trigger CSRF. The public advisory identifies the _table_id request parameter but does not disclose the endpoint, sink, or exact missing neutralization that permits script execution. Exploitation requires low-privileged access, high-complexity conditions, and victim interaction; successful script execution can submit requests in the victim's session, including on 3.2.0 prereleases.

Is a vulnerable build present?
Compare these published version ranges with your installed build and any vendor patches.
- Affected versionversion=< 2.7.11
- Affected versionversion=>= 3.0.0-alpha, < 3.1.2
- Affected versionversion=>= 3.2.0-alpha1, < 3.2.0
